Davisboro emerges from the red-clay earth as a quiet testament to the enduring influence of the Georgia landscape, where the meandering path of Williamson Swamp Creek marks the rhythm of the surrounding woodlands. It lies 34.8 miles north-northeast of Dublin, GA (from Dublin, GA: bearing 29°T), and is situated 11.7 miles east of Sandersville.
